Strategic AI Infrastructure Investments in Emerging Markets
Emerging markets are increasingly positioning AI as a cornerstone of national development. Brazil's $4 billion Brazilian Artificial Intelligence Plan exemplifies this shift, aiming to reduce reliance on foreign tech giants while fostering regional innovation. Similarly, Kazakhstan has attracted $3 billion in investments from NVIDIANVDA-- and OracleORCL--, leveraging its geopolitical centrality to become a regional AI hub. Kenya's "Silicon Savannah" is another case study, with MicrosoftMSFT-- and Huawei expanding cloud computing and AI development to support Kenya's National AI Strategy. These investments are not merely about economic diversification but about reclaiming technological sovereignty in a world dominated by U.S. and Chinese tech ecosystems.
Meanwhile, the U.S. has allocated $350 billion to AI infrastructure in 2025, with hyperscalers like Microsoft and Amazon driving job creation in construction, energy, and engineering. However, the strategic imperative for emerging markets lies in their ability to leapfrog traditional developmental hurdles. Saudi Arabia's Vision 2030, for instance, is integrating AI into its data infrastructure to transition from oil dependency to a knowledge-based economy. These initiatives highlight a global trend: AI infrastructure is becoming a strategic asset, with nations competing to build the next generation of digital ecosystems.
AI-Driven Social Equity Solutions
Beyond economic growth, AI is proving transformative in addressing social inequities. In healthcare, Nigeria's HelpMum has developed "MamaBot," an AI-powered app that provides maternal health advice in local languages, while Lesotho's Ministry of Health uses Qure.ai to detect tuberculosis via X-rays. These tools are cost-effective, scalable, and critical in regions with acute shortages of medical professionals.
Financial inclusion is another frontier. Indonesia's Kredivo uses AI to assess creditworthiness and approve loans within minutes, enabling underbanked populations-particularly women and entrepreneurs-to access financial services. Non-profits like Kiva are also leveraging AI to connect global lenders with borrowers in emerging markets, democratizing access to capital.
In education, AI is bridging gaps in resource-poor settings. Rural China's use of mixed reality (MR) devices for science education has improved learning outcomes, while AI-powered tools in Sub-Saharan Africa are addressing teacher shortages by providing localized content and real-time feedback. UNESCO emphasizes that AI in education must be human-centered to avoid exacerbating disparities, underscoring the need for ethical frameworks and teacher training.
Challenges and the Path Forward
Despite these advancements, challenges persist. Power grid capacity and sustainability remain critical bottlenecks for AI infrastructure in emerging markets. For example, Brazil's National AI Strategy must balance rapid deployment with renewable energy integration to avoid straining its grid. Geopolitical tensions also loom large: as nations prioritize domestic AI capabilities to reduce reliance on foreign cloud providers, investors must navigate shifting regulatory landscapes.
The U.S. Stargate Initiative, which streamlines AI infrastructure development through private-sector partnerships, offers a model for balancing innovation with oversight. Similarly, emerging markets must adopt policies that ensure AI's benefits are equitably distributed. This includes investing in digital literacy, data privacy frameworks, and public-private partnerships to scale solutions.
